Having a problem. When my boost comes on my motor leans out. It's not poping or running back, but I back out when I see my A/F meter drop.



Here is a sample of a data log I ran today.



rpm psi Throt % Air F Inj mS Duty % Advan BTDC A/F mV

4520 0.9 33 98 8.608 36 25 747

4520 1.8 36 98 4.488 40 25 643

4640 3.3 38 99 4.624 36 23 96

4760 3.4 46 99 5.040 39 21 13



See the problem? I have checked my fuel pressure and it's a solid 40 PSI all the time. My injectors have been serviced and blueprinted. (Stock 550cc units).



I can't figure out why it's dropping out so.

Yes Haltech E6K. I'm set for stagged and one is 30in Vac to 0 and the other starts at 0 PSI and goes to 30. Increasing through out the map for both. Stagging bar number is 12 which is right when the boost starts. So that could be the problem.



Weird that a set of injectors would blueprint out fine. The motor doesn't stumble or stutter one bit.



I've driven a stock Rx7 with a bad set of 2ndries and it fell on it's face at about 4000 RPM when they were suppose to come on. A swap of the injectors determined that. I guess I'll try the same thing here.

i would move the staging bar a little and then just richen it up, its only running 40% injector duty, you have tons of room for more fuel

You are correct... Just remapped and took it for a spin... Running on 2 injectors it runs AWESOME. Never went LEAN.



Looking at my datalog I have a few times I hit 100% duty cycle @ 4500 RPM, but my o2 sensor never showed under 800mv.



So WTF RC Engineering? I sent them all 4 of my injectors and 2 are bad?
